A Marketing Research Director is responsible for overseeing and managing the market research activities within an organization. They lead a team of researchers to gather, analyze, and interpret data to provide insights that drive marketing strategies and decision-making. The director ensures that research projects are conducted effectively and efficiently, utilizing various methodologies such as surveys, focus groups, and data analysis. They collaborate with cross-functional teams to identify market trends, consumer preferences, and competitive intelligence to develop effective marketing campaigns and product strategies. The director also plays a crucial role in identifying new market opportunities and assessing the potential risks associated with them. They stay updated with industry trends and emerging technologies to enhance research methodologies and tools. Overall, the Marketing Research Director plays a pivotal role in guiding marketing efforts by providing valuable insights based on comprehensive market research.

Marketing Research Director salary in Germany
Average Yearly Salary of Marketing Research Director in Germany is approximately 125,815 EUR (125,956 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.

Is Marketing Research Director a well paid job?
Yes, our data show that Marketing Research Director is a very well paid job. With years and experience the salary might increase even further, resulting in higher satisfaction.What is considered a high salary for Marketing Research Director?
High salary for Marketing Research Director would be somewhere between 138,397 EUR and 182,432 EUR. However this is an estimation based on Gaussian Distribution.How much can you save working as Marketing Research Director in Germany?
Living in Germany the approximate monthly expenses are: 2,136 USD. This amount covers basic needs such as food, housing, clothing, healthcare and education costs for a single person.
